00.01.Linux系统服务连不上活跃连接路径变化
问题描述
在新装的系统中,重启网卡时出现如下报错:
[root@localhost ~]# service network restart 正在关闭接口 eth0: 设备状态:3 (断开连接) [确定] 关闭环回接口: [确定] 弹出环回接口: [确定] 弹出界面 eth0: 活跃连接状态:激活的 活跃连接路径:/org/freedesktop/NetworkManager/ActiveConnection/1 [错误]
经查询,发现这是因为RedHat自家开发的 NetworkManager 管理工具与 /etc/sysconfig/network-scripts/ifcfg-ethx
配置不同步造成的。这个问题通常出现在安装了图形界面的 CentOS 或 RHEL 系统中,原因是图形界面的 NetworkManager 服务与传统的网络脚本不一致。
解决方案
-
关闭 NetworkManager 服务
如果你不需要使用 NetworkManager,或者想要避免图形界面与传统网络配置不一致导致的报错,可以通过停止 NetworkManager 服务来解决此问题。
# service NetworkManager stop
-
禁用 NetworkManager 服务(防止重启后自动启动)
为了避免 NetworkManager 在每次重启后自动启动,可以禁用该服务。
# chkconfig NetworkManager off # service NetworkManager stop
-
重启网络服务
在停止 NetworkManager 服务后,重新启动网络服务,问题将得到解决。
# service network restart
结果
重启网卡后,问题消失:
[root@localhost ~]# service network restart 正在关闭接口 eth0: [确定] 关闭环回接口: [确定] 弹出环回接口: [确定]
注意事项
此方法适用于图形界面安装的 CentOS/RHEL 系统。其他环境下,可能需要根据具体情况进行调整。
本文来自博客园,作者:{雾里看浮光(南知意)},转载请注明原文链接:{https://www.cnblogs.com/JaseLee}